Contents:
Klezmer music and Yiddish songs ; Songs of the Lodz Ghetto (Brave Old World)
Old-time Klezmer music (Epstein Brothers)
The golden age ofYiddish theater [excerpts] (Seymour Rexsite and Miriam Kressyn with Zalmen Mlotek)
500 years of Sephardic-Oriental mysticism and liturgical song (Rabbi Jacob Adi, ... [et al.])
Ashkenazic liturgical song (Cantors Naomi Hirsch, Marcel Lang and Bernhard San)
A treasury of Judeo-Spanish folksongs (Bienvenida Aguado, ... [et al.)
Chassidic rock music (Piamenta)
Participant:
Various performers.
Notes:
Recordings made by Sender Freies Berlin Jan.-Apr. 1992, from the concert series "Traditional and popular Jewish music" ("Traditionelle und populäre jüdische Musik") accompanying the exhibition "Jüdische Lebenswelten" organized by the Berliner Festspiele 1992.
Compact discs.
Digital recordings.
Program notes in German with English translation, and texts in the original languages with English translations (74 p.) inserted in container.
